Subject: Order-cutoff rule — read before your first shift

Hi, and welcome to the Crumbwise on-call rotation! Quick context for the eng sync: our bakery order-cutoff rule closes next-day orders at 9pm local per store. If a store owner complains that orders are still trickling in after cutoff, it's almost always a timezone mismatch in their store config, not a bug in the rule engine. Don't hotfix anything solo. The full cutoff logic, override steps, and escalation list are on the internal page below.

wiki page, yaguf-bawig: https://jira.norvacorp.internal/browse/display/view/b5a061abb09d

**CI note: timezone weirdness in report exports**

Heads up, support folks — if a customer says their Ledgerpine export shows times shifted by a few hours, it's probably the CI image. The export workers got rebuilt last week and the base image defaults to UTC, while older workers used the account's locale. Fix is rolling out; meanwhile tell customers the data itself is fine, just the display offset. Affected exports carry the build token shown below.

build token for bajof-tahop: htk4_a981

Subject: Welcome to on-call — Ledgerlight audit-log viewer

Hi, and welcome to the rotation. Plugin authors will mostly page you about events missing from the Ledgerlight viewer; nine times out of ten the plugin is writing to the wrong stream, not a viewer bug. Check ingest lag before escalating. The triage flowchart and escalation criteria are kept on the page below.

operations page: https://jenkins.zemvarcloud.local/job/merge_requests/repo/build/73930b4b30f0a8ed

Hello plugin authors,

Next Thursday, Corbexa will run a disaster-recovery drill for the RestockRoute vending-machine restock planner. During the failover window, plugin callbacks will be replayed against the standby scheduler, so please ensure your handlers are idempotent and tolerate duplicate route assignments. No customer restock data will be altered. To re-register your plugin against the standby environment during the drill, authenticate with the recovery passphrase provided below.

vault phrase of hahip-tajeg = quenax-briath-briax